Instructions: Read the conversation below. Take turns reading both parts. When you are ready, try the “Creative” conversation.
A:Hey, James. How are you?
B: Hello, Stephen. I’m feeling great. Thanks for asking. And what about you?
A: I’m doing just fine. Hey, I was wondering- what do you like doing during your free time? What are your favorite hobbies?
B: Well, I really enjoy (1) gardening, (2) reading books, and (3) playing basketball.
A: Really? And why do you enjoy (1) gardening ?
B: I like (1) gardening because it helps me to relax. And I can eat what I grow.
A: That’s great. And why do you enjoy (2) reading books ?
B: I like (2) reading because I can learn so much information about anything I’m interested in.
A: Hey, me too! And why do you enjoy (3) playing basketball?
B: I like (3) playing basketball because I love the competition and exercise.
A: I see. So when do you have time to do these types of activities? In the morning, evening, while at work or school, during the weekends, or on holidays?
B: Well, I usually (have/never have) time to (1) garden on the weekends, and (2) read books in the evening before bed, and (3) play basketball on Sunday afternoon.
A: Are there any new hobbies that you would like to start doing in the future?
B: Yeah, I’m really interested in carpentry or metalwork, because I like building things with my hands.
A: That would be nice. Hey, are there any unique talents or skills that you have? Or any hobbies that you enjoy that most people wouldn’t do?
B: Well, I really like learning and speaking Chinese. I live in Taiwan, so I get to speak Mandarin Chinese everyday.
A: Did you ever consider turning one of your hobbies/talents into a future career?
B: Oh, yeah. When I was young I wanted to play in the NBA, but I’ve given up on that dream. Maybe someday I’ll chose a simpler life, and be a full time farmer. That would be interesting.
A: Wow, that’s such a interesting idea. So, do you have any plans for this upcoming weekend?
B: Well, I think I’m going to take my family for a hike on Saturday, and go to church on Sunday.
A: That sounds great. Hey, would you like to go watch a movie with me and some friends this evening.
B: Oh, I’d love to but I already have plans. Maybe next time. Thanks for the invitation.
A: Sure thing. See you next time.
B: Yeah, you too. Goodbye!
